S.E. Hinton Interview

By Eve Shelton-Jones

In late October eleven ninth graders had the opportunity to meet and talk with S.E. Hinton durig a taping of "Rap Around," the Channel 4 teenage talk show. S.E. Hinton, as you probably know, is the author of The Outsiders. What you may not knoow is that the author is a she - the "S.E." in her name stands for "Susan Eloise" - and that her novel has sold more than eight million copies since its publication .

One reason for the novel's popularity is that it is told from the viewpoint of an orphaned fourteen year-old named Ponyboy. Stephanie Beattie added another perspective and echoed the sentiments of the other ninth graders, when she said: "I loved the book because I felt as if she were talking about my school and my friends."

The occasion for Channel·4's invitation to participate in this interview was the thirtieth anniversary of the publication of The Outsiders. The ninth graders who partiepated were: Stephanie Beattie, Jana Conkey, Derek Coughlin, Jessica Cunha, Lauren Halloran, Lindsay O'Connell, Simone Pereira, Jennifer Pimentel, Michelle Romeo, Jackie West, and Nicole Wolsky.
